The Book Of A Thousand Sins by Wrath James White
4.0
Something to be said for Wrath James White ā he has never pretended to be anything but what he is: an incredibly descriptive, no-holds-bar graphic author.
I will never describe him as a literary marvel, but damn if Iām not entertained by what comes out of his mind. This short story collection is no exception. The title story burned images into my brain while rushing along at a feverish pace. His stories always leave me wondering about the depths of depravity that hides in people. Another entertaining read.
